My 2019 in Books

I might not have mentioned elsewhere on this blog that, in spite of my writerly ambitions, I’m a tragically slow reader. In 2018 I managed to read some 18 books — that’s 1.5 books a month — and considered it an achievement. In 2019 I planned to read 24 — the whole of 2 books a month! — but in the end managed only 20. Here they are, and how I remember them:

Playing Skyrim–Beyond Skyrim

It’s not a witticism. Beyond Skyrim is one of those overambitious projects you sometimes hear about with regards to the highly modable games from Bethesda’s The Elder Scrolls series that aim to expand the already huge game world by adding new provinces or rebuilding entire previous games in the latest one. But unlike most (possibly all) of them, Beyond Skyrim is actually playable. And it’s excellent. The new content is of DLC quality, virtually indistinguishable from the vanilla game, and where it differs, it’s mostly for the better.
